Default Matrox TripleHead2go

I read in Oleg's Answers that he is going to support this feature in SOW. This has made my whole year. If anyone has used this you know what I mean. Anyone that hasn't, I can only tell you that you are missing HALF of the experience of immersion that you can get from this sim. It was as much of a shock when I got it working as it was when I got my TRACKIR working. I am frankly really surprised that more people don't have it. This should be near the top of your list of hardware required. Not only do you get three monitors but you get your FOV expanded by 2/3. Think about that for a minute. I bet most people read this quickly and go"that's interesting, I can't afford it right now" or "to much trouble to set it up" or "I am used to my set-up I have now". If any of that sounds like you, too bad. But the guys that are looking for an edge over there adversaries or want to move toward realism, for the minimal investment you need, the return is unbelievable. I spent about $380 for the TRH2GO and I just pulled out some old monitors to try it. I didn't stop flying for 7 hours. Yes, it will work on just about any three monitors. It wont look right till you get three of the same but ou can fly till you do. I urge you guys to buy one and hook it up, you can always return it if you hate it. But having your wingman and enemy planes behind you visible, how much is that worth?
